What Drives Success

As an Engineered Sales Manager, you will be responsible for driving HVAC system specifications by building strong consultative relationships with consulting engineers, design-build contractors, facility managers, and other key influencers. You'll serve as a trusted technical advisor, helping customers design and specify complete HVAC solutions while growing market share throughout your territory.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ain relationships with consulting engineers, select design-build contractors, facility managers, and OEM customers to secure HVAC system specifications.
  • Provide technical expertise on HVAC applications, system design, and product selection.
  • Support consulting engineers, contractors, design firms, and end users by educating them on current and emerging HVAC products and solutions.
  • Conduct product presentations, lunch-and-learns, and technical training sessions for customers and industry partners.
  • Serve as the subject matter expert on specialty products, application engineering, and system design.
  • Advise customers on Federal, State, and Local code requirements, as well as ASHRAE standards and design guidelines.
  • Monitor market trends, customer needs, and competitive activity to identify new business opportunities and respond to changing market conditions.
  • Partner closely with the commercial sales team, engineering firms, contractors, and OEM customers to develop long-term strategic relationships and drive specification growth.

Location & Travel:This is a 100% remote position supporting the FL territory. Candidates must reside in the Orlando, Tampa or Miami area and be willing to travel throughout the territory to meet with customers and partners.

What We Are Looking For
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and relevant experience.
  • 3-5 years of experience in commercial HVAC sales, engineering, or a related technical sales role.
  • Proven ability to build relationships and effectively communicate with consulting engineers and the mechanical engineering community to drive system specifications.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to deliver engaging presentations and technical training.
  • Strong sales acumen with a collaborative, team-oriented approach.
  • Solid understanding of commercial HVAC products, applications, and industry trends.
  • Demonstrated success in relationship building, active listening, influencing, negotiating, and time management.
  • Knowledge of sales principles, including product promotion, consultative selling, marketing strategies, and customer engagement.
  • Strong customer service orientation with the ability to assess customer needs, provide effective solutions, and maintain high levels of customer satisfaction.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software.

What We Offer

Compensation: This is a salaried exempt role. The starting salary range for this role and market is between $98,000 to $150,000 annually. Factors that may affect starting salary include geography/market and the skills, education, experience, and other qualifications of the successful candidate. Under the plan, target compensation is anticipated to be 70% base salary and 30% commission.  New hires are guaranteed to receive at least the target commission for six months.  The competitive compensation plan also includes an uncapped bonus structure based on performance exceeding 100% of the plan across three individual categories. The bonus amount increases as performance surpasses quota, so the potential payout is not fixed and can grow as over-quota achievements increase.

Benefits: Subject to applicable eligibility requirements, the following benefits are offered for this role: tuition reimbursement; medical, dental, and vision insurance; prescription drug coverage; 401(k) retirement plan; short-term disability insurance; 8 weeks paid birthing leave; 2 weeks paid bonding leave; life and long-term disability insurance.

Depending on date of hire, and subject to applicable eligibility requirements, new employees in this role also receive up to: 12 days paid time off, 2 paid well-being days, 1 paid volunteer day, 12 paid holidays, and 3 floating holidays per year.
